Ealing 54-6 Ampthill: Kernohan’s try is pick of the bunch for Trailfinders

Ealing hold Amps tryless at Vallis Way to go two from two in the Championship

EALING Trailfinders continued their perfect start to the new season with an eight-try victory over Ampthill.
Director of rugby Ben Ward said: “Ampthill were very physical but we managed to stand up to them and our defence was really good. We scored some great tries and can’t wait to take on Coventry next week.”
Ealing started with intensity and scored their first try after five minutes, captain Rayn Smid bundling over the line to mark his 100th appearance with a try.
